Improving Warehouse Ventilation for Productivity

In the bustling realm of warehouse operations, maintaining a healthy and productive environment is paramount. Adequate ventilation plays a crucial role in this endeavor, ensuring worker comfort and safety while optimizing operational efficiency. By implementing best practices for warehouse ventilation, facility managers can create a workplace where employees thrive and productivity soars.

One fundamental aspect of effective warehouse ventilation involves identifying potential sources of contaminants. These may include dust generated by material handling, fumes emitted from machinery, or volatile organic compounds (VOCs) released from cleaning products. Thoroughly assessing these sources allows for the development of a targeted ventilation strategy.

A well-designed warehouse ventilation system should incorporate a blend of mechanical and ambient methods. Mechanical ventilation systems, such as exhaust fans and air purifiers, actively remove contaminants from the air. Meanwhile, natural ventilation techniques, like strategically placed windows and vents, leverage airflow patterns to facilitate fresh air circulation.

  • Optimize airflow by installing adequate ventilation equipment throughout the warehouse, particularly in areas with high concentrations of contaminants.
  • Utilize a regular maintenance schedule for ventilation systems to ensure optimal performance and prevent breakdowns. This includes cleaning filters, checking fan belts, and inspecting ductwork for leaks or damage.
  • Evaluate air quality regularly using sensors and air sampling techniques. Conducting periodic air quality assessments helps identify potential issues and allows for timely adjustments to the ventilation system.

By adhering to these best practices, warehouse managers can create a well-ventilated environment that fosters employee well-being, reduces the risk of respiratory problems, and promotes overall productivity.
